Presbyterian [1]
(1): ( a.) Of or pertaining to a presbyter, or to ecclesiastical government by presbyters; relating to those who uphold church government by presbyters; also, to the doctrine, discipline, and worship of a communion so governed.
(2): ( n.) One who maintains the validity of ordination and government by presbyters; a member of the Presbyterian church.
